Gresham/Bowler opened their Track season at Wausau West with Girls taking 5th out of 11 teams and the Boys taking 7th out of 10. Val Cerveny took 3rd in Shot Put, 6th in triple jump Hannah Cerveny 3rd in Long jump Maddie Haffner 2nd in 3200, 5th in 1600 Josie Cerveny 6th in 800 Cami Gourley 4th in 3200 Bryson Nelson 5th in 3200 Emmitt Kietlinski 1st in Long Jump, High Jump, and Triple Jump Beau Brunner 8th Long Jump Girls 4x400 relay 3rd Girls 4x800 3rd Girls 4x200 4th The team did amazing for their first meet against some really hard division 1 teams.

Congratulations to Lizzy May! She is the first to reach the “Olympic Master” level of the Band Scale Olympics, and claim one of the gold medals! To do this, she had to play all 12 majors scales, one octave, from memory for Miss Sargent. This is no small feat for a 6th grade student, and the music department is so proud!
